Artist Statement
The emotional tone of this artwork encapsulates the tension between desire and emptiness. The contrasting palette reflects saturated, warm hues of desire with soft, low-saturation shades of emptiness. The main collision occurs in the center, where the rich coral and orange colors meet the muted blue and charcoal tones, symbolizing the struggle of craving against the constraints of containment. The layout features a broken frame, suggesting a boundary that is both intact and feelingly disrupted, allowing for glimpses of intensity while maintaining an overall quiet pressure. The chosen patterns of hinge and stairs symbolize the rise and fall of emotions, embodied through color placement and tonal shifts.
